The Tag Team Championship is Global Extreme Wrestling's two-person tag team title. It has been active since 2001, with only minor periods of being vacated.
Due to the GEW records fire, almost no information on the title exists from before May 2006. In addition to the reigns below, Knuckles is known to have been a former champion, and Undertaker and Triple H are known to have had one and two reigns respectively, although their partners' identities are currently unknown. Currently, and pending further records being discovered, GEW management only recognises reigns by Knuckles, Jeff Hardy, Undertaker and Triple H prior to those on the list below. Forty-three different individuals are currently recognised as former or current Tag Team Champions by GEW.
The current champions are Sah'ta Thor and Amy Ngoudje. They are in their first reign as a team, which is Thor's second reign overall and Ngoudje's first.
